The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in England requiring SailPoint sk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ited SailPoint over the 6 months leading up to 31 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
31 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 611 805 793
Rank change year-on-year +194 -12 +304
Permanent jobs citing SailPoint 68 45 112
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in England 0.14% 0.050% 0.13%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 0.78% 0.25% 0.45%
Number of salaries quoted 30 22 50
10th Percentile £65,950 £51,625 £53,861
25th Percentile £75,000 £56,625 £53,970
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£85,000 £65,000 £58,405
Median % change year-on-year +30.77% +11.29% -31.29%
75th Percentile £91,875 £75,000 £77,715
90th Percentile £100,375 £104,625 £97,750
UK median annual salary £85,000 £65,000 £57,810
% change year-on-year +30.77% +12.44% -31.99%
